Software project management based on using historical data for planning and current measures for project tracking can provide significant gains in quality, productivity, and schedule predictability. Defect data from inspections and test were key elements of process improvement initiatives that Bull HN Information System's Enterprise Servers Operation in Phoenix, Arizona, started in 1989. By examining data from several projects, project members see how data is used to better understand a development project's dynamics. Feedback from the project metrics is used to improve processes. Feedforward of data enables mid-course analysis and schedule adjustments in a planned manner, rather than in a reactive, firefighting mode. Data collected over a four-year period enabled those managing similar projects to estimate from previous project history and to compare current performance to past experience. By recognizing the pervasiveness of defects in software development and taking steps to count and measure the impacts of defects on schedules and productivity, project managers gained a better understanding of their projects and ultimately manufactured a better product in less time.
